    Introducing E-Farmer Management System for Dedicated Economic Centres in Sri Lanka to Reengineer the Current Marketing Process

    Abstract
    Abstract: Dedicated Economic centers are established all around the country. With the long-term objective of Improve and enhance the sustainability of the agriculture sector in Sri Lanka. such as Ensure obtaining reasonable prices for agriculture producers, Farmers for their crops by providing a targeted market for their valuable crops, create an opportunity to distribute areaspecific agricultural products among people in all parts of the island. But still, there are some serious problems which are not come up with feasible solutions the major problem in the current system is the lack of coordination between economic centers, farmers, and buyers. So, the main objective of this research paper is to give a feasible solution for those identified problems and enhance the productivity of Sri Lankan agrobusiness. This proposed system will connect farmers, buyers, and economic centers into one platform and provides Information about current production, Price Indexes, and current market condition. This Farming information management system for agricultural dedication centers is developed as a web-based application. The system uses a centralized database system where all the clients (Farmers, agrarian officers, and other users from the economic center) can connect to the system.
